Pelvic Support/Reconstruction Surgery

Pelvic support surgery and reconstruction Prolapse is an all-inclusive term, referring to a protrusion through the vagina that creates an uncomfortable feeling, pressure, or even pain. In addition to protrusion and pressure symptoms, a rectocele may cause difficulty with bowel movement, while a cystocele may result in difficulty urinating.

Laparoscopic surgery uses tiny incisions to correct prolapse, resulting in minimal pain and discomfort. It can be performed on an outpatient basis, and decreases the length of recovery time.
